diff --git a/test/features/interception.spec.js b/test/features/interception.spec.js index 6d37860abf..4a3e905be7 100644 --- a/test/features/interception.spec.js +++ b/test/features/interception.spec.js @@ -373,7 +373,7 @@ module.exports.addTests = function({testRunner, expect, FFOX, CHROME, WEBKIT}) { expect(requests.length).toBe(2); expect(requests[1].response().status()).toBe(404); }); - it.skip(FFOX)('should not throw "Invalid Interception Id" if the request was cancelled', async({page, server}) => { + it('should not throw "Invalid Interception Id" if the request was cancelled', async({page, server}) => { await page.setContent(''); await page.interception.enable(); let request = null; diff --git a/test/frame.spec.js b/test/frame.spec.js index fc9e81fbfe..be4ca9f008 100644 --- a/test/frame.spec.js +++ b/test/frame.spec.js @@ -59,7 +59,7 @@ module.exports.addTests = function({testRunner, expect, FFOX, CHROME, WEBKIT}) { }); describe('Frame.evaluate', function() { - it.skip(FFOX)('should throw for detached frames', async({page, server}) => { + it('should throw for detached frames', async({page, server}) => { const frame1 = await utils.attachFrame(page, 'frame1', server.EMPTY_PAGE); await utils.detachFrame(page, 'frame1'); let error = null; diff --git a/test/navigation.spec.js b/test/navigation.spec.js index 9603c9c2e6..b37387e6fd 100644 --- a/test/navigation.spec.js +++ b/test/navigation.spec.js @@ -410,7 +410,7 @@ module.exports.addTests = function({testRunner, expect, playwright, FFOX, CHROME expect(response).toBe(null); expect(page.url()).toBe(server.PREFIX + '/replaced.html'); }); - it.skip(FFOX)('should work with DOM history.back()/history.forward()', async({page, server}) => { + it('should work with DOM history.back()/history.forward()', async({page, server}) => { await page.goto(server.EMPTY_PAGE); await page.setContent(` back diff --git a/test/page.spec.js b/test/page.spec.js index e7b0d3bfd6..87c408a6a1 100644 --- a/test/page.spec.js +++ b/test/page.spec.js @@ -927,7 +927,7 @@ module.exports.addTests = function({testRunner, expect, headless, playwright, FF expect(await page.evaluate(() => result.onInput)).toEqual(['blue']); expect(await page.evaluate(() => result.onChange)).toEqual(['blue']); }); - it.skip(FFOX)('should not throw when select causes navigation', async({page, server}) => { + it('should not throw when select causes navigation', async({page, server}) => { await page.goto(server.PREFIX + '/input/select.html'); await page.$eval('select', select => select.addEventListener('input', () => window.location = '/empty.html')); await Promise.all([